New Mini Owner Here in Kentucky

Hello All-

Just wanted to introduce myself to the online community. I'm the proud new owner of a 2007 Mini Cooper "S". I purchased him from the local Cincinnati Mini Store. Unfortunately, after only 5 days of driving and a sudden drop in ambient temperatures, I began hearing a rhythmic knocking coming from the engine--a turbo-diesel noise. I returned to the dealer to have a new timing chain kit installed. While the repair would have been covered under the warranty I purchased, it would have taken a few weeks to have an inspector come by to review the car and approve the repair. Thankfully, the dealer went to bat for me and actually had Mini pay for the repairs. I picked the car up today and everything is back to spec.

Having driven a '91 Isuzu Trooper throughout college, a new car was definitely in store for me. Being a traveling nurse (or sorts), 12 miles to the gallon from the Troop was really starting to wear on me--that and the constant need for new parts became a real thorn in my side.

I opted for a Mini Cooper "S" because I heard they're great fun to drive, offer pretty decent fuel efficiency, and, well, I've always wanted one. I'm really looking forward to getting to better know my Mini.

I'm excited to be a Mini owner and am looking forward to interacting with my fellow owners.
